#b6f528 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b6f528 is composed of 71.4% red, 96.1% green and 15.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 25.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 83.7%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 78.4 degrees, a saturation of 91.1% and a lightness of 55.9%. #b6f528 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ff50 with #6deb00. Closest websafe color is: #ccff33.

#b6f528 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b6f528 has RGB values of R:182, G:245, B:40 and CMYK values of C:0.26, M:0, Y:0.84,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 11990312.

Shades and Tints of #b6f528
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070a00 is the darkest color, while #fcfff6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b6f528
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#919687 is the less saturated color, while #b9fe1f is the most saturated one.
